The Evolution of Muay Thai: Techniques and Trends

Muay Thai, often dubbed the "Art of Eight Limbs," has a rich history spanning centuries. From its humble beginnings in ancient Siam, it has evolved into a dynamic and globally recognized combat sport. Early Muay Thai primarily focused on raw power and close-range fighting, utilizing strikes with fists, elbows, knees, and shins.

Throughout history, the art evolved its techniques, incorporating elements of wrestling, clinch work, and strategic footwork. Modern Muay Thai emphasizes a blend of power and finesse, with fighters showcasing incredible speed, agility, and technical prowess.

The training methods have also changed. While traditional gyms still value discipline and grueling conditioning, contemporary fighters often incorporate focused training programs to enhance specific skills like kickboxing or grappling.

Trends in Muay Thai continue to develop, showing the sport's flexibility. The rise of professional leagues and international competitions has sparked a competitive spirit, driving fighters to constantly perfect their techniques.

Furthermore, the increasing recognition of Muay Thai in mainstream culture has introduced it with a wider audience, inspiring new generations of practitioners.
